WebLitho-Density Tool This tool is an improved and expanded version of the standard formation density tool. In addition to the bulk density, the tool measures the photoelectric absorbtion index (Pe) of the formation which enables lithological interpretation to be made without prior knowledge of porosity. WebPorosity Measurement. Total porosity may consist of primary and secondary porosity. Effective porosity is the total porosity after the shale correction is applied. Rock porosity can be obtained from the sonic log, density log or neutron log. For all these devices, the tool response is affected by the formation porosity, fluid and matrix.

Web13 apr. 2024 · April 13th, 2024 - By: Brian Bailey. While only 12 years old, finFETs are reaching the end of the line. They are being supplanted by gate-all-around (GAA), starting at 3nm [1], which is expected to have a significant impact on how chips are designed. GAAs come in two main flavors today — nanosheets and nanowires.
